{WORKING ROOT FOR T-MOBILE LG LEON LTE 5.1.1 LOLLIPOP}

.....so after a week & some change of endless searching for a working root method, following tons of half-assed directions, trying about 4-5 "1-click root scripts" and installing a bunch of different root APK's with absolutely no luck I finally successfully rooted the T-Mobile LG Leon 5.1.1 Lollipop by putting together a few things I found on this forum.....

This method (with files linked to this post) ONLY works on the T-Mobile LG Leon LTE 5.1.1 Lollipop by downgrading to the previous 5.1.1 Lollipop firmware before the current version.....I did not try it on the MetroPCS variant so please do not inbox me asking "hey bro does this work on MetroPCS??" because I do not know.
It will more-than-likely work if you follow the instructions but you'll need the MetroPCS firmware .kdz file, not the one linked to this post...just find the file and follow the instructions below.

You need the following;
T-Mobile LG Leon Drivers-----> Windows | MAC
LG Flash Tool 2014-------------> LG Flash Tool 2014
LG Leon H34510d kdz file-----> H34510d kdz file
Kingroot 4.5---------------------> Kingroot 4.5

Once you've downloaded the above files follow these directions to successfully root your LG Leon from T-Mobile.

*********************************************************
~BACKUP WHATEVER YOU DO NOT WANT LOST~
~This method will wipe all your apps, pictures, etc.~
*********************************************************


|[ INSTRUCTIONS]|
1.) Download & extract above files to desktop.
2.) Put device in download mode by powering off completely. Then, while the phone is still off, hold the "volume up" button for 2-3 seconds and insert the USB wire (make sure the USB is connected to your desktop/laptop) until download mode screen appears.
3.) Run LG Flash Tool 2014
4.) Once the LG Flash Tool is open, leave (or select) "Select Type" As "CDMA".
5.) Change "PhoneMode" to "CS_EMERGENCY".
6.) Click the folder icon to browse your computer and select the "H34510d_00.kdz" file.
7.) Click the button that says "CSE Flash".
8.) Click on the Start button.
9.) Click on "Clear Update Registry".
10.) For "Country" select "Different Country"
11.) For "Language" select "English" (or whatever language you use).
12.) Click "Okay" and let the LG Flash Tool recognize your device. The Flash Tool will do it's thing and load the file onto your device...it takes a minute or two so just let the process run it's course. Once it hits 100% your phone will reboot once or twice- leave it plugged in -you will see the Android with the spinning blue "thing" in his belly for a second or two then the device will reboot. Wait until the Flash Tool progress bar is at 100% on your computer and your phone shows the setup page (like when you turn it on the very first time) and unplug the device.
***Once the downgrade starts you may see a popup window that says something like "Can not connect to servers" but it is just an error...you can see the timer & progress bar running behind the popup, just ignore it.***
You are now downgraded to the 10d firmware {H34510d}.
13.) Install Kingroot 4.5 and run that and it will take about 30-60 seconds to acheive root.

###ENJOY ROOT ACCESS###

If, for some wild, crazy reason this fails and you soft-brick your device (which shouldn't happen if you follow the directions) check this thread to unbrick: Unbrick T-Mobile LG Leon

Thanks to Yazuken1 and IPRJ25 for some of the info that helped me put this together.

I had the LG Leon a while ago and I have rooted it with Kingroot 4.1 and replaced kinguser with Supersu using SupersuMe Pro 9.1.2 (other versions didn't work, they hangs on the phase 1). I don't share my apk since it is a paid app. But I still recommend using Supersu rather than kinguser as it is more compatible with a lot of root apps (e.g. Titanium Backup tells you that you MAY have some problems with it, Busybox by Stericsson doesn't work telling you that you are not rooted ecc.) But there is still a little workaround if you don't want to use SupersuMe (and of course it's free :) ): when you have kinguser install this: https://play.google.com/store/apps/details?id=com.bitcubate.root.busybox.complete&hl=it , (it's mandatory for Flashfire to run) install Busybox within the app and then install Flashfire and with the app flash the Supersu.zip . Flashfire says that it isn't tested on this device but I flashed Xposed, Titanium Backup system zip and Dolby Atmos on mine. Only thing I noticed that restoring the backup of Flashfire simply doesn't work (idk why). But for sure it flashes zips with no problems. :)
